experiment with housewives trading the futures during one of the most volatile weeks in the last 50 years

the ladies traded very well, netting  2K for the week, using simple support & resistance levels, with good risk management and money management techniques.

they traded 2 indices: Russell2000 and the DJIA, at  contract per trade, with an initial risk of 250; they added some practrice tardes in some currencies later in the week fro the experience: mostly Aussie and Canadian dollars

the 3 of them around 2 laptops and 2 extra screens doing their collaboration was very instructive and motivational to the rest of the trading room.  They  were very good and learned a lot and will soon be prepared to go live, now that they have a good understanding of the platform

Trading experimentation: ticks vs price charts

August 13, 2011 2 comments

A futures wheel as described by Jerome C. Glenn.

Image via Wikipedia

am very pleased and interested in the results of using tick charts in short term futures trading

tick charts do a good job of mapping the psychology implied in price changes in a regular wave, calibrated by decisions made, rather than in decisions over time

in some ways it is the conceptual equivalent of point and figure charts, and renko charts

we are finding that 200 ticks per candle is probably too  sensitive to mood changes and increases trading frequency in a large index like the Dow, but that 800 ticks looks very good for intraday trading

these are things you only learn by trying, and our live trading workshop did a good job of testing the  ideas
